Deep Foundation Repair in Sarasota, FL
Deep fo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's underlying structure. This service is essential for projects involving sinking or settling foundations, cracked walls, uneven floors, or other signs of foundation movement. Property owners typically seek this type of repair for residential homes, especially when experiencing structural concerns that may compromise safety or property value. Understanding the specific signs of foundation problems and the scope of repair options can help homeowners make informed decisions before requesting services.
These repairs often involve methods such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ization to restore a foundation's support. Homeowners should consider factors like the age of the property, soil conditions, and the severity of any foundation movement when exploring repair options. Proper assessment and planning are crucial to ensure the stability of the structure and to prevent future issues. Common Deep Foundation Repair Jobs
Pier and footing repair - stabilizes foundations affected by settling or shifting soil.
Basement wall stabilization - prevents bowing and cracking in basement walls.
Soil stabilization - improves ground support for structures built on unstable soil.
Deep underpinning - reinforces existing foundations to prevent further settlement.
Column and pier repair - restores support to load-bearing structures.
Settlement correction - addresses uneven sinking that impacts building stability.
Deep Foundation Repair Questions
What is deep foundation repair? Deep foundation repair involves strengthening or stabilizing a building’s foundation when issues like settling or shifting occur, ensuring long-term stability.
What signs indicate a need for foundation repair? Common sign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ls.
What types of projects typically require deep foundation repair? Projects often involve addressing foundation settlement, pier or piling repairs, or stabilizing structures affected by soil movement.
How does deep foundation repair benefit property owners? It helps prevent further damage, maintains property value, and ensures the safety and stability of the building structure.
